Capital Project Opportunities Newsletter
The Quarterly Newsletter provides information on active and prospective procurement opportunities for capital projects, upcoming engagement events, and guidelines for working with Metro.
The newsletter is intended to aid consultants, contractors, manufacturers, and suppliers, as well as the public, gain visibility into the pipeline for architectural and engineering services, professional project management services, and construction projects.
